AIDSO opposes hike in medical fee

Belagavi: Members of All India Democratic Students Organisation ( AIDSO ) protested in the city condemning the introduction of non-resident Indian quota (NRI) and the fees hike in the government medical colleges, here on Friday.The protesters took out a rally from Rani Channamma Circle to the deputy commissioner’s office and submitted a memorandum to the DC.They said the medical education minister’s plan to introduce 10% quota for NRIs in government medical colleges was unconstitutional. “The government intends to increase the fee for undergraduate medical courses from Rs 17,000 to Rs 50,000 per year and from Rs 40,000 to Rs 3.5 lakh for post graduate courses, which will be a burden on poor students,” the protesters said and urged the state government to withdraw the proposal.Raju Ganagi, Nikhil Hosamani, Basayya Hireamath, Kiran Harijan, Mahantesh Billur and medical students were present at the protest..
